For the people starting in the summer I really recommend reading ahead . Don't wait till your first day to start studying because the program is very fast paced as it is and winter term is longer than summer so I can imagine how much faster it'll be in the summer , the material so far in not complicated. Keep in mind I'm only in process 1 but its a lot of info all at once so it makes its difficult to balance. But it's not impossible, at the end of the day it comes down to how bad you want it and how hard your willing to study to achieve your goal. Overall i am very pleased with the program. I dont have anything negative to say. Good luck guys !

Completely agree! I'm in process 1 at south. Please read ahead. Especially on vital signs and physical assessment. And please don't be ever be late. if you're the type to sleep through alarm clocks I would try to fix that issue now especially if you're going to south. When you start the program get as many lab hours as you can. Do not aim for the minimum, get as much practice as you can on vitals, physical assessment and skills!!! So far I'm getting through the program with a B in process 1 I'm so glad I read ahead. 3 more weeks till process 1 is over!!!! :) p.s. Practice answering critical thinking questions now!!! It will save you on the exam!!!

I go to central and our process theory exams come out the fundamentals of nursing book, I would recommend finding out what chapters each exam will cover based on your campus and start reading, and like the person before me said practice doing critical thinking questions. At the end of every chapter there's review questions. Do them! They really help prepare you for exams. The questions are very similar to the format of our tests.
